Annual Report Filing Timeline SEC Rules and Corporate Scheduling
The U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ission SEC requires publicly traded companies to submit an annual report on Form 10-K within a specific timeframe after the end of their fiscal year. The deadlines vary depending on the company’s classification
Large Accelerated Filers Must file the 10-K within 90 days after the fiscal year-end.
Accelerated Filers Have 75 days to submit the report.
Non-Accelerated Filers Are granted up to 120 days to complete the filing.
This structured timeline allows companies of different sizes to manage their reporting obligations effectively while maintaining a consistent rhythm of public disclosure.

Key Components of the 10-K Report
The 10-K is a comprehensive document that provides a detailed overview of a company’s financial health and operational performance. It typically includes the following key sections
1. Business Overview Describes the company’s core operations, market position, and competitive landscape.
2. Financial Statements Includes audited balance sheets, income statements, and cash flow statements.
3. Management’s Discussion and Analysis MDA Offers insights from company leadership on financial performance, operational results, and future outlook.
4. Risk Factors Identifies internal and external risks that could impact future performance.
5. Corporate Governance and Executive Compensation Details the board structure and executive pay arrangements.
6. Legal Proceedings Discloses any ongoing litigation or regulatory investigations.
Together, these sections form the backbone of the annual report, offering stakeholders a transparent and in-depth view of the company’s operations and potential risks.
Pre-Filing Preparations Critical Details Not to Overlook
Preparing the annual report is a complex, cross-functional effort involving finance, legal, and communications teams. Companies must pay close attention to several key areas during the preparation process
1. Ensure Data Accuracy
Financial data forms the core of the report. Errors or omissions can lead to regulatory penalties or damage investor trust. Companies should complete audits in advance and maintain open communication with auditors.
2. Compliance and Risk Disclosure
The SEC requires accurate, complete, and timely reporting. Companies must update disclosures in line with evolving regulations, including new mandates around AI, cybersecurity, and supply chain issues.
3. Clarity in Language and Formatting
The annual report is both a legal document and a communication tool. Language should be clear, professional, and free from misleading or ambiguous statements. The format must also meet SEC technical requirements to ensure smooth submission.
4. Internal Review and External Communication
Establish a multi-tiered review process to catch errors before submission. Additionally, coordinate with the investor relations team to prepare for potential market reactions following the report’s release.
